kostenloser Webspace werbefrei: lima-city


Mehrere Werte mit | in DB Trennen und einzeln abfragen

lima-cityForumProgrammiersprachenPHP, MySQL & .htaccess

  1. Autor dieses Themas

    tecfreak

    tecfreak hat kostenlosen Webspace.

    Hallo,

    problem1 gelöst chon taucht problem2 auf!
    Ich möchte im Shop den User sachen kaufen lassen.
    Habe das jetzt so in der DB:
    http://www.youscreen.de/pzvgsnbf21.jpg

    Aber ich möchte das der User sich z.B.: eine Waffe einzeln kaufen kann oder sich zwichen dem Red Dot und dem Zoom Visier entscheiden kann. Muss ich das alles einzeln machen also einfügen oder kann ich das lassen so wie es ist?

    mfg
  2.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!

    lima-city: Gratis werbefreier Webspace für deine eigene Homepage

  3. So, wie es bisher ist, ist es sicher nicht optimal. Lesestoff: Stichwort Normalisierung

    So, wie es jetzt ist, könntest Du bei einer Abfrage z.B. mit INSTR() arbeiten, oder, wenn Du die Optionen in den Feldern nicht mit |, sondern mit Kommata trennst, auch mit FIND_IN_SET()

    Ich würde Dir, allein schon, weil es langfristig übersichtlicher und flexibler ist, die saubere Form empfehlen, die im o.a. Tutorial gezeigt wird.
  4. Autor dieses Themas

    tecfreak

    tecfreak hat kostenlosen Webspace.

    Ich versteh das ganze nicht so richtig. Hast du noch ein anderes Tutorial?
  5. statt in eine Spalte,die waffen heißt, alle Waffen reinzuschreiben, macht man sich eine extra Tabelle mit Namen Waffen, in der jeweils der User und die entsprechende Waffe in einer zeile steht.
    ALso so:
    tabelle Waffen
    user Waffen
    1 EIn Gewähr
    1 Ein anderes Gewähr
    4 Ein Gewähr
    4 EIne andere Waffe

    Du kommst aber langfristig nicht umhin, das Prinzip der Normalisierung wirklich komplett zu verstehen
  6. Ich muss eigentlich sagen, das ich vor 2-3 Jahren auch mit www.peterkropff.de gelernt habe. Wenn du das nicht versteht, dann bist du in der WebProgrammierung falsch.
  7. tecfreak schrieb:
    Ich versteh das ganze nicht so richtig.

    Das weißt Du bereits nach knappen 6 Minuten? :holy:

    Hast du noch ein anderes Tutorial?

    Ja, aber bei denen ist die benötigte Aufmerksamkeitsspanne noch länger. Die würden Dir daher auch nicht weiterhelfen.:wink:

    Beitrag zuletzt geändert: 14.11.2013 21:10:20 von fatfreddy
  8. Autor dieses Themas

    tecfreak

    tecfreak hat kostenlosen Webspace.

    unlikus schrieb:
    statt in eine Spalte,die waffen heißt, alle Waffen reinzuschreiben, macht man sich eine extra Tabelle mit Namen Waffen, in der jeweils der User und die entsprechende Waffe in einer zeile steht.
    ALso so:
    tabelle Waffen
    user Waffen
    1 EIn Gewähr
    1 Ein anderes Gewähr
    4 Ein Gewähr
    4 EIne andere Waffe

    Du kommst aber langfristig nicht umhin, das Prinzip der Normalisierung wirklich komplett zu verstehen


    Verstanden ;)
    Danke. !
  9.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!

    lima-city: Gratis werbefreier Webspace für deine eigene Homepage

Dir gefällt dieses Thema?

Über lima-city

Login zum Webhosting ohne Werbung!